In a bid to streamline financial processes, small business owners and accountants are increasingly turning to automated receipt management systems. This shift is designed to alleviate the burdensome task of manual receipt handling and expense categorization. The source reports that these systems not only save time but also enhance accuracy in financial reporting.
Prevalence of Automated Systems in Small Businesses
The adoption of these automated systems is particularly prevalent in small business settings, where the need for efficiency is paramount. By automating receipt management, businesses can significantly reduce the risk of audits, as these systems create a verifiable audit trail that enhances tax compliance.
Benefits of Implementing Automated Receipt Management
Moreover, the implementation of such technology not only saves time but also minimizes human error, allowing business owners to focus on growth rather than administrative tasks. As the trend continues to gain momentum, it is clear that automated receipt management is becoming an essential tool for modern financial management.
